That could really be a great thing! The problem is that Mersenne primes are "sparse", i.e. there aren't many of them. Finding one could be like minting a new block, but it would be so rare that it won't be practical. For crypto, you would need something with many solutions, but then it's probably not so useful to find yet another solution...
you also generally speaking need something that is much easier to verify than it is to generate. I'm not saying it's impossible, but I don't think that "verifying" a protein folding in the "cryptocurrency" sense is a meaningful operation in the "useful" way you're hoping it to be.